Don’t be alarmed by that lightning on the horizon, by the peel of thunder in the skies overhead, that’s just the gods alerting us to the new that Yngwie Malmsteen – the latter-day Mozart of neoclassical shred guitar – has announced a new album.
Mr Malmsteen has shared the video for its first single, and it will hit stores worldwide on November 13 via Music Theories Recordings/Artone Label Group.
He has a work ethic all right, but even so, Hell Or High Water was a significant undertaking.
“I had around 80 or 90 tracks finished, and then I had to decide which ones were the strongest.”
